In this lesson students will analyze the lessons learned from Dr. Seuss's Yertle the Turtle and compare them to 18th century philosophies. Students will also evaluate the extent the Age of Enlightenment philosophers had on the creation of the Declaration of Independence.

    Three Day Lesson 1. The students will analyze the lessons learned from Dr. Seuss’s Yertle the Turtle. 2. The students will identify philosophers from the Age of Enlightenment and explain their philosophies. 3. The students will compare and contrast the lessons learned from Dr. Seuss’s Yertle the Turtle to Enlightenment philosophies of the 18th Century. 4. The students will evaluate the extent the Age of Enlightenment philosophers had on the creation of the Declaration of Independence.
